import type { TaskColumn } from "./settings.js";
export type FusionTask = {
id: string;
title: string;
description: string;
column: TaskColumn;
status?: string;
};
export type ListTasksFilter = {
limit?: number;
offset?: number;
column?: TaskColumn;
status?: string;
q?: string;
includeArchived?: boolean;
};
export class FusionApiError extends Error {
constructor(
public readonly status: number,
public readonly body: unknown,
) {
super(`Fusion API request failed: ${status}`);
}
}
type FetchLike = typeof fetch;
export class FusionApiClient {
constructor(
private readonly baseUrl: string,
private readonly token: string,
private readonly fetchImpl: FetchLike = fetch,
) {}
async listTasks(filter: ListTasksFilter = {}): Promise<FusionTask[]> {
const params = new URLSearchParams();
if (typeof filter.limit === "number") params.set("limit", String(Math.floor(filter.limit)));
if (typeof filter.offset === "number") params.set("offset", String(Math.floor(filter.offset)));
if (typeof filter.q === "string" && filter.q.trim()) params.set("q", filter.q.trim());
if (typeof filter.includeArchived === "boolean") params.set("includeArchived", String(filter.includeArchived));
const query = params.toString();
const data = await this.request<FusionTask[]>("GET", `/api/tasks${query ? `?${query}` : ""}`);
let tasks = Array.isArray(data) ? data : [];
if (filter.column) tasks = tasks.filter((task) => task.column === filter.column);
if (filter.status) tasks = tasks.filter((task) => task.status === filter.status);
return tasks;
}
async getTask(id: string): Promise<FusionTask> {
return this.request<FusionTask>("GET", `/api/tasks/${encodeURIComponent(id)}`);
}
async createTask(input: { title: string; description: string; column?: TaskColumn }): Promise<FusionTask> {
return this.request<FusionTask>("POST", "/api/tasks", input);
}
async updateTask(id: string, patch: Partial<Pick<FusionTask, "title" | "description" | "status">>): Promise<FusionTask> {
return this.request<FusionTask>("PATCH", `/api/tasks/${encodeURIComponent(id)}`, patch);
}
async moveTask(id: string, column: TaskColumn): Promise<FusionTask> {
return this.request<FusionTask>("POST", `/api/tasks/${encodeURIComponent(id)}/move`, { column });
}
async retryTask(id: string): Promise<FusionTask> {
return this.request<FusionTask>("POST", `/api/tasks/${encodeURIComponent(id)}/retry`, {});
}
async refineTask(id: string, feedback: string): Promise<FusionTask> {
return this.request<FusionTask>("POST", `/api/tasks/${encodeURIComponent(id)}/refine`, { feedback });
}
private async request<T>(method: string, path: string, body?: unknown): Promise<T> {
const response = await this.fetchImpl(`${this.baseUrl.replace(/\/$/, "")}${path}`, {
method,
headers: {
Authorization: `Bearer ${this.token}`,
"Content-Type": "application/json",
},
body: body === undefined ? undefined : JSON.stringify(body),
});
const payload = await response.json().catch(() => undefined);
if (!response.ok) {
throw new FusionApiError(response.status, payload);
}
return payload as T;
}
}
